There are two kinds of mounts. A shallow one and a deep one. To get hub-cap outside you need the deep one. I got a plain black cover for my (shallow) one. Looks ok.
This is mine. I had the shallow mount, but wanted to have the wheel facing the other way. Rather than buy a new mount I drilled and tapped some long bolts, so that they screw onto the existing studs on the shallow mount.
